- Notifications
You must be signed in to change notification settings - Fork184
techreagan/vue-nodejs-youtube-clone
Folders and files
| Name | Name | Last commit message | Last commit date | |
|---|---|---|---|---|
Repository files navigation
This is the frontend (VueJS) of the VueTube clone
Backend RESTFUL API RepositoryAPI
- Sign in / Sign Up to create channel
- Video
- Upload video
- Upload video thumbnail
- Watch video
- Increase Views
- Like and dislike video
- Download video
- Comment & reply for video
- Update video details
- Delete video
- Subscribe to a channel
- View liked videos
- Trending
- Subscriptions
- History
- Watch history
- Search history
- Settings
- Modify channel name and email
- Change password
- Upload channel avatar
Create .env.development.local for development then .env.production.local for production ready app.Then put in your api URL
VUE_APP_URL=http://localhost:3001npm installnpm run servenpm run buildnpm run lintDelete the screenshot folder if you download this code (Screenshots folder is 3.14mb in size).
If you like the UI, I developed it in a seperate repoVueTube
This project is licensed under the MIT License
Reach me on twitter@techreagan
About
This is the frontend (VueJS) of the Youtube clone called VueTube.
Topics
Resources
Uh oh!
There was an error while loading.Please reload this page.
Stars
Watchers
Forks
Releases
No releases published
Packages0
No packages published
Uh oh!
There was an error while loading.Please reload this page.


















